Safety, trust & environment
Visiting pups are accompanied on all trips outside in our large fenced yard. The dogs sleep in our brand new indoor kennel building that has heat/AC, bright lighting, and Wi-Fi for music and tv during down times . They have elevated beds with soft, washable bedding and their own set of bowls for meals that are washed daily. All dogs are required to be up to date on vaccines and a registration must be completed that is required by the state of Illinois as we are a licensed kennel. That information can/will be emailed to you at booking. We are in a daycare/kennel setting. Large and small dogs are separated in different rooms and play areas but dogs will be playing, supervised with other dogs throughout the day. We have, on average, 10 dogs per day. Of course holidays and some weekends are a little busier, maxing out about 20. It’s a fun, safe environment with 5x5x6 individual kennels that provide a soft bed and room to move. The dogs are also safe from any type of food aggression as they eat in their private kennel. Their personal items are stored separately and kept safe in their personal kennel for the duration of their stay. You’re welcome to bring bedding and toys if you’d like along with their daily food and treats. We do provide refrigeration if your dog eats refrigerated food or has med needs.

A typical day
The dogs enjoy a very active day, playing outside weather permitting a lot of the day, supervised. We kennel for meals, an afternoon rest and for sleep. We have water bowls available all day and feed twice a day. Lots of belly rubs, toys and play time too - we’ll discuss your goal for the stay and work hard to meet your needs :)
